Nursing standards of practice is a process through which basic nursing care is to be provided and codes to be adhered to by staff and practitioners in healthcare. The American Nurses Association entrusts responsibilities to its members as the primary link in the development of resources for official use (Swansburg and Swansburg 87). The process of the formulation of the nursing standards will be done using the Scope of Practice Tree used in the department of health. The tree asks important questions that guide the process. Some of these questions include; are the acts to be done allowed by the practice act of nurses or restricted? Are the acts in line with the set standards? Do the staffs possess updated skills to perform the acts? Is the staff ready to bear the consequences of such actions?

Once the process furnishes adequate answers to these questions through the various entities involved in the formation of the standards of practice, then it is safe to proceed and establish the standards for a particular facility. However, these standards have to adhere to the state and national regulations (Schroeder 594). Among the main entities that might be involved in the process include; Assessment of the practice standards, Analysis of the standards to determine their compliance with the state and national regulations, expected outcome identification, planning for the processes, implementing, and finally the evaluation of the whole process. This last part is done to perform adjustments to the process for conformity in areas that have been identified in the other steps. The standards of care are found at both national and state levels and are formulated by bodies like specialty nursing organizations, educational institutions, and several government agencies in the department of health (Buppert 199).
